Abstract
In a method for the manufacture of a silver catalyst having silver deposited on a porous inorganic carrier in conjunction with at least one reaction accelerator selected from the group consisting of alkali metals and thallium to be used for the production of ethylene oxide, the improvement comprising the steps of depositing silver on the porous inorganic carrier in conjunction with at least one reaction accelerator selected from the group consisting of alkali metals and thallium thereby preparing an activated silver catalyst and subsequently subjecting said silver catalyst to a high-temperature treatment at a temperature in the range of 550.degree. to 950.degree. C. in an inert gaseous atmosphere having an oxygen concentration of not more than 3 volume percent in the final step.
